版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、无线传感器网络(Zigbee)网关的的通信协议网关是通过串口与PC机相连的。PC机可以通过串口发送采集命令和收集采集数据,为了能有效管理这些数据,需要执行统一的数据通信格式。下面介绍该系统中所使用的通用数据格式。每一帧数据都采用相同的帧长度,且都带有帧头、数据和帧尾。具体格式如下:|&3j节"顷节如上所示,每一帧数据的长度都是32字节。除帧头和帧尾,每一帧数据都由命令头、发送地址、有效数据和校验和组成。命令头:所执行的命令。地址:所访问模块的长(前8字节)/短地址(后2字节)。数据:传送各个参数、变量与返回值及各种需要突发发送的数据。校验和:从命令头到数据尾的加和校验,用于确
2、定数据正确与否。注命令头、地址的长地址部分和数据都采用ASCII码。这个系统的命令分为3种,分别为?读命令R(ead泡括读各个传感器或网络状态命令。?测试命令T(est)测试LED、BEEP或电池寿命命令。?扩展板命令E(xtend)控制和读扩展板命令。卜面介绍具体命令格式1读命令1)RASRAS(ReadallSens。诙传感器。RAS具体格式如下:|&|RAS00000001*"1牢J.11命令头地址数据1校验利帧尾需要加入地址和数据地址:传感器模块地址;数据:GM*/WD*传感器种类包括光敏:GM;温度:WD;可调电位器:AD。(1)读取成功返回格式如下:地址:加入传感
3、器模块地址。数据:传感器+测量值(ASSII码)。其中光敏:GM+*(3字节ASII码);温度:WD+*(3字节ASII码);可调电位器:AD+*(3字节ASII码)。(2)读取失败返回格式如下|&|HAS00000001*)*率牢率整卓牛琲丰率率拿事暮C*命4i地址数据1校验和帧1RNDRND:无线网络发现RND具体格式如下:RN1)亭半辛*亭零牢咛*平EO3*辛辛辛*半冲李率律寮学宰丰c亭j命4kJ卜头地iJ址数1据校验和峋1星需要加入地址和数据地址:无;数据:无,只需要命令头。(1)读取成功返回格式如下:返回网络中节点的性质:RFD(终端节点)/ROU(路由器)+地址+第几个例如
4、:如果返回第1个RFD节点,则数据段为RFD01。具体格式如下:|RND00000001刑rFD0嗦*相牢卓*卓申*C*命令头地址数据校脸和帧尾(2)读取成功结束格式如下RND率*END*率*琳*C*ALi1H命令头地址数据校验和帧尾2.测试命令1)TLDTLD:测试传感器LED灯。TLD具体格式如下:需要加入的地址和数据一一地址:传感器节点地址;数据:控制数据。数据:C(控制亮灭)+D+LED号(3/4)+X(X=0灭,X=1亮);T(LED闪烁)+D+LED号(3/4)+X(X=0灭,X=1闪烁)。返回格式:返回格式与发送格式相同,只是数据有变化。(1)测试成功:返回数据为OK。具体格式如
5、下:测试失败:返回数据为E0。具体格式如下:2)TBLTBL:传感器电池寿命。TBL具体格式如下:&|IBI.0000000E辱中*主寄平玷尊字*C*iLn1命令头地址数据校验和帧尾需要加入的地址和数据地址:传感器模块编号;数据:无(1)读取成功返回格式如下:|&|THL()00()0001叫3.2V驰虹MM"""(1求1命4【J*头地1iii址数据校段11佥和帧尾地址:被测传感器模块的地址数据:电压(3字节ASII码,精确到0.1V例如3.2V)。(2) 读取失败返回格式如下:TBETBE:BEEP测试。TBE具体格式如下:|IB10000000
6、1"1*率推冲半申中麻*申中率律中CiJ散令头地址数据校验和帧尾需要加入的地址和数据地址:传感器模块地址;数据:1为发声,0为不发声。(1)测试成功返回格式如下地址:传感器模块地址数据:OK。(2)测试失败返回格式如下()000000!*血令头地址数据校验和帧尾例如:如果想读取网络内某个节点的WD传感器,只需往网关发送一帧命令即可,网关会通过无线访问该节点,然后节点从无线返回该节点温度值给网关,网关再从串口以同样的数据格式返回此节点的温度值。具体格式如下:首先PC从串口发送此命令到网关:如果网关读取成功,则将多串口返回数据以上表示读取物理地址为00000001(ASCI码)的节点的温度传感器,节点
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 买车代收保险合同范例
- 养殖场及山羊承包合同范例
- 县城养老机构服务合同范例
- 摊位简易租赁合同范例
- 厂房隔墙拆除合同范例
- 安装门面合同范例
- 样填写家庭装修合同范例
- 印厂合同范例
- 产品购货合同范例
- 信号控制电缆采购合同范例
- 《春秋》导读学习通超星期末考试答案章节答案2024年
- 中标方转让合同协议书
- 人教版(2024)七年级地理上册3.2《世界的地形》精美课件
- APQC跨行业流程分类框架(PCF)V7.4版-2024年8月21日版-雷泽佳编译
- 国家开放大学本科《理工英语3》一平台机考总题库2025珍藏版
- 中药学总结(表格)
- 2022-2023学年广东省深圳市高一(上)期末数学试卷-解析版
- 城市绿地系统规划智慧树知到期末考试答案章节答案2024年浙江农林大学
- 大数据与人工智能营销智慧树知到期末考试答案章节答案2024年南昌大学
- 电力系统分析智慧树知到期末考试答案章节答案2024年山东建筑大学
- 九年级数学上册第一学期期末综合测试卷(湘教版 2024年秋)
评论
0/150
提交评论